# Supplier Renewal — Hemlan Fabricators (Managers/Board Only)

The Darrow Alloy supply contract is up for renewal in ninety days. Performance metrics were satisfactory: on-time delivery at 97%, defect claims minimal. Proposed terms include a modest price adjustment and improved lead-time guarantees. Procurement recommends renewal pending board approval. Context on how this supports forward plans appears immediately below.

board note of bawep-tajef: Queniusek Systems plans to raise the Quenvan list price by 53.1 percent in March. The pricing group signed off on a budget of $176.4 million for Project Drueth. The renewal with Casionix Partners closes at $142.5 million a year, 8.3 percent below the last contract. Project Fraax slips by six weeks because of the tooling delay.

## Digest Scheduling: Limits & Quotas

Welcome aboard! Mailbarn batches digest emails into hourly windows, and each tenant gets a capped slot count so nobody hogs the scheduler. If a tenant blows past their quota, overflow digests roll into the next window automatically — no alerts, no drama. The defaults below are safe to tweak in staging first. Current tuning constants are:

tuning table, faduf-baduf:
PRIORITIES = {
    "ulavan": 191,
    "silys": 750,
    "goriel": 238,
    "kelmir": 66,
    "wendor": 432,
}

## Step 2: Swap out the old Crankshaft queue

If your plugin enqueued jobs through Crankshaft's homegrown queue, good news: the new Relayline broker is a near drop-in, just with real retries and dead-lettering instead of the old pray-and-poll approach. Replace your enqueue calls with the Relayline client, keep your job payloads as-is, and make sure your worker registers under the same queue name. Point the client at these broker settings.

service settings:
[casax]
port = 6379
team = rusir
host = casax.zemvarhq.corp
region = outer-4
access_code = ac_9808ce
timeout_ms = 1500

Restock planner runbook — SnackRoute edition. When the planner stalls, it's almost always the inventory sync from the VendGrid machines, not the routing solver. First, check the job queue in the planner dashboard; anything older than 20 minutes means the sync worker died. Restart it with `snackroute worker restart sync`. It'll immediately re-auth against the internal StockFeed API, so make sure the env file has a valid credential. For local testing, use the key below.

API key for hahag-kafof: vxb3-kck